Clash Of Clans : Getting Started

Clash Of Clans also known as COC is one of the top grossing mobile game on Android and IOS. This is a mobile MMO strategy game developed by Supercell, a Finland based video game company. There have been countless updates since the game launched in 2012.

About COC

Clash of clans is an addictive strategy game. It is more successful than another strategy game called BOOM BEACH also developed by Supercell because of the idea of clan.

In this article we will show town hall 1 and town hall 2 farming base which you’ll get right after you download the game and start playing. But before getting started you should know a couple of things that will give you a clear idea about this game.

In this game you can team up with a clan and participate in 10-10, 15-15, 20-20 up to 50-50 war. Every clan can have at most 50 members. A Clan Castle is needed for creating or joining a Clan. It is a castle that houses troops which you can use for placing reinforcement troopss during an attack, or use troops as defenders when your base is under attack. But when you start this game at town hall 1 you will have your clan castle broken. It will cost 10,000 gold to rebuild. But you’ll require town hall level 3 to build a clan castle as your storage won’t have that much space in TH1 or TH2.

FIrst time COC

When you start playing COC for first time you will find your village with nothing but a town hall and some obstacles. TH Level 1 allows you to place down 1 gold mine and elixir collector, as well as 1 storage per each, 1 barracks and 1 army camp. Elixirs are used to train troops, upgrade troops when you get a laboratory and making spells when you have a spell factory. Gold are used to build/upgrade buildings, walls etc.

Aside from gold and elixir, the game also uses gems as a currency. Do Not Waste GEMS! Give them time to finish construction. You will find gems after clearing obstacles and completing achievements. But you should use gems only for getting your builders. Initially you’ll get one builder. You’ll have 500 gems left. You have to get your 2nd builder when you’re playing the tutorial. The 3rd builder will cost 500 gems. But don’t worry, if you don’t waste gems you can have even 4th builder in couple of weeks. We’ll explain that technique later.

You end up at Town Hall level 2 by the end of the article. After upgrading your town hall to level 2, You’ll get 1 barrack, 1 gold mine, 1 elixir collector, an archer tower, 25 walls. You can actually farm some at Town Hall 2 before upgrading – it is very easy. All you have to do is make 20-30 Barbarians (be sure to upgrade your Army Camp to hold 30 units as soon as you can) and then start attacking others. Look for villages with exposed resources and just drop your Barbarians right on top of the resources. You can easily loot to cap within a raid or two. Do not worry about losing your shield

I recommend you to max out everything before upgrading to your next town hall level, so that you’ll be the toughest opponent for those who’ll attack you. And your resources will get the maximum security. As for town hall 2, you can max out your gold mines and elixir collectors to level 4, Both storages to level 3, barracks to level 4 and army camp to level 2. You’ll upgrade your cannon, archer tower and wall to level 2 as well.

Upgrading barrack to level 4 will give you some new kinds of troops. They are Archers, Giants and Goblins. But it is recommended that you will use only barbarins in this stage because they cost less to train and can take more damage than archers/goblins.

Once you have maxed out your base you will upgrade your town hall to level 3. It will cost 4000 gold and 3 hours. In the mean time you should attack other’s bases and make your storage full so that when you get to the next town hall you’ll be able to build/upgrade your defence in a shorter time.
